WebLutheranism is a movement within Christianity that began with the Protestant Reformation in the 16th century. It rejects papal and ecclesiastical authority in favour of the Bible, affirms five of the traditional seven sacraments, and insists that human reconciliation with God is effected by divine grace alone, appropriated solely by faith. Web14 Dec 2015 · Dec 14, 2015 Charles V, the Holy Roman Emperor at the time (1521), invited Martin Luther to the Diet of Worms (an assembly). At first, Charles V referred to Luther's 95 theses as "an argument between monks" and maintained cordiality with Luther. Later, Charles V would outlaw Luther and his followers, the Protestant Lutherans.
